期刊文献+
共找到25篇文章
< 1 2 >
每页显示 20 50 100
二叉树先序遍历的非递归算法讨论 被引量:3
1
作者 王家聚 汤岩 《集美大学学报(自然科学版)》 CAS 北大核心 2001年第1期69-71,共3页
在传统的二叉树递归算法的基础上 ,讨论了两种非递归算法 .一种是较常见的算法 ,但这种算法有重复的操作 ,因而笔者做了修改 ,形成了第二种算法 ,并在时间复杂度和空间复杂度方面对这两种算法的优劣进行了探讨 .
关键词 二叉树 先序遍历 非递归算法 时间复杂度 空间复杂度 设计
下载PDF
完全二叉树非递归无堆栈先序遍历算法的研究 被引量:3
2
作者 王兴波 《计算机工程与设计》 CSCD 北大核心 2011年第9期3077-3081,共5页
通过对满二叉树的层次结构、顺序序列与先序序列三者之间解析关系的研究,得到了满二叉树的层次结构及顺序序列与先序序列之间互相转换的算法,并由此演绎出了非递归无堆栈方式的完全二叉树先序遍历以及先序与顺序互转算法。该算法可在常... 通过对满二叉树的层次结构、顺序序列与先序序列三者之间解析关系的研究,得到了满二叉树的层次结构及顺序序列与先序序列之间互相转换的算法,并由此演绎出了非递归无堆栈方式的完全二叉树先序遍历以及先序与顺序互转算法。该算法可在常数时间内完成单个结点的查询,在线性时间内完成整个序列的遍历或互转。以精准二进制编码的解析公式为基础,易于与位运算结合,不仅适合常规程序设计,而且适合于嵌入式及相关的专业开发。通过一个简单的示例,说明了该算法在虚拟植物建模方面的应用。 展开更多
关键词 二叉树 存储 先序遍历 非递归无堆栈 虚拟植物
下载PDF
二叉树的先序遍历和中序遍历的非递归算法 被引量:6
3
作者 黄霞 《电脑开发与应用》 2010年第1期53-54,59,共3页
从二叉树先序遍历递归算法的执行过程的分析入手,总结出二叉树先序遍历的实质,从而得出利用栈的二叉树的非递归算法。最后,再从分析二叉树中序遍历与先序遍历过程实质的不同之处,得出了二叉树中序遍历的非递归算法。重点在于对二叉树先... 从二叉树先序遍历递归算法的执行过程的分析入手,总结出二叉树先序遍历的实质,从而得出利用栈的二叉树的非递归算法。最后,再从分析二叉树中序遍历与先序遍历过程实质的不同之处,得出了二叉树中序遍历的非递归算法。重点在于对二叉树先序和中序遍历过程实质的分析。 展开更多
关键词 二叉树先序遍历 二叉树中遍历 递归算法 非递归算法
下载PDF
先序遍历动态四叉树碰撞检验算法的研究
4
作者 张泉 王太勇 《机床与液压》 北大核心 2011年第13期118-120,95,共4页
为了改善数控仿真过程的显示效果,提出基于先序遍历的动态四叉树碰撞检验算法。运用此算法,碰撞检验的数据运算量大幅减少,改善了数控仿真显示效果及流畅性。并通过一个零件加工仿真实例验证了该算法的可行性和有效性。
关键词 四叉树 仿真 先序遍历 碰撞检测
下载PDF
由遍历序列确定二叉树的算法 被引量:4
5
作者 赵刚 李昆 《南昌航空大学学报(自然科学版)》 CAS 2010年第1期55-59,共5页
文章针对如何由二叉树的遍历序列来唯一确定二叉树的问题,提出了用两种遍历序列唯一确定一棵二叉树的方法。已知先序遍历和中序遍历或者已知后序遍历和中序遍历可以唯一确定一棵二叉树,但已知后序遍历和先序遍历就不能唯一确定了,只有... 文章针对如何由二叉树的遍历序列来唯一确定二叉树的问题,提出了用两种遍历序列唯一确定一棵二叉树的方法。已知先序遍历和中序遍历或者已知后序遍历和中序遍历可以唯一确定一棵二叉树,但已知后序遍历和先序遍历就不能唯一确定了,只有当要确定的树没有度为一的结点时,所确定的二叉树才是唯一的。对此文中给出了说明,并利用Turbo C实现了相应的算法。. 展开更多
关键词 先序遍历 遍历 遍历 二叉树
下载PDF
怎样由遍历序列确定二叉树 被引量:3
6
作者 康牧 陈向奎 《洛阳师范学院学报》 2003年第2期56-58,共3页
在文 [1 ]至文 [4]中都介绍了遍历一棵二叉树的三种方法 :先序遍历、中序遍历和后序遍历 .每棵二叉树的先序遍历序列、中序遍历序列和后序遍历序列都是唯一的 .但是不同的二叉树的先序遍历序列或中序遍历序列或后序遍历序列有可能是相同... 在文 [1 ]至文 [4]中都介绍了遍历一棵二叉树的三种方法 :先序遍历、中序遍历和后序遍历 .每棵二叉树的先序遍历序列、中序遍历序列和后序遍历序列都是唯一的 .但是不同的二叉树的先序遍历序列或中序遍历序列或后序遍历序列有可能是相同的 .就如我们已知一个关系要求能求出它的关系矩阵 ,已知一个关系的关系矩阵也能求出关系矩阵所表示的关系一样 ,要求我们不但能从二叉树求它的遍序序列 ,而且能从二叉树的遍历序列求出它们所表示的二叉树 .在文 [1 ]中只指出 :给定结点的先序序列和中序序列可唯一确定一棵二叉树 .但文 [1 ]没有给出证明 .本文指出了由后序遍历序列和中序遍历序列也可唯一确定一棵二叉树 。 展开更多
关键词 二叉树 先序遍历 遍历 遍历 位置树
下载PDF
先序和后序序列恢复二叉树的非递归算法 被引量:1
7
作者 李昆 赵刚 《南昌航空大学学报(自然科学版)》 CAS 2010年第3期30-32,共3页
针对先序和后序序列不能唯一恢复一棵二叉树的问题,文章提出先序和后序序列在有些情况下是可以唯一恢复一棵二叉树的。即在结点的度只为0或2的二叉树中是可以由先序和后序序列唯一恢复的。对此文中给出了说明,并利用Visual C++6.0实现... 针对先序和后序序列不能唯一恢复一棵二叉树的问题,文章提出先序和后序序列在有些情况下是可以唯一恢复一棵二叉树的。即在结点的度只为0或2的二叉树中是可以由先序和后序序列唯一恢复的。对此文中给出了说明,并利用Visual C++6.0实现了相应的算法。 展开更多
关键词 非递归算法 二叉树 先序遍历 遍历
下载PDF
一种由遍历序列构造二叉树的改进算法 被引量:1
8
作者 王防修 刘春红 《武汉轻工大学学报》 2016年第3期68-73,共6页
针对现有构造二叉树的算法无法适用于具有相同元素的遍历序列,提出了一种解决该问题的递归算法。该种算法以现有的递归算法为基础,通过引入遍历序列的标志序列,依据标志序列中元素之间的关系,从理论上证明了三种由遍历序列构造二叉树的... 针对现有构造二叉树的算法无法适用于具有相同元素的遍历序列,提出了一种解决该问题的递归算法。该种算法以现有的递归算法为基础,通过引入遍历序列的标志序列,依据标志序列中元素之间的关系,从理论上证明了三种由遍历序列构造二叉树的算法都具有递归性。根据遍历序列构造二叉树的递归原理,设计了三种不同的由遍历序列构造二叉树的递归算法。通过算例仿真表明,使用笔者设计的算法可为具有相同元素的遍历序列构造二叉树。 展开更多
关键词 先序遍历 遍历 遍历 标志 递归算法
下载PDF
二叉树后序遍历非递归算法的改进研究
9
作者 章晓勤 《佳木斯大学学报(自然科学版)》 CAS 2013年第6期926-928,共3页
通过分析二叉树后序遍历过程的特点,结合二叉树先序遍历非递归算法的思想,对传统的二叉树后序遍历非递归算法进行了改进,提出了基于"先序遍历"思想的二叉树后序遍历非递归算法,并在课堂教学中进行了应用,取得了良好的教学效果.
关键词 二叉树 先序遍历 遍历 非递归算法
下载PDF
二叉树遍历教学方法研究 被引量:8
10
作者 张亚萍 陈得宝 侯俊钦 《牡丹江师范学院学报(自然科学版)》 2010年第4期69-70,共2页
为了加深学生对二叉树遍历的理解,在讲解递归算法的同时补充三种遍历的非递归算法.对于算法的讲解都是按照算法思想、算法、实例图示跟踪、实例演示的步骤进行,收到很好的效果.
关键词 数据结构 先序遍历 非递归 二叉树
下载PDF
数据结构中遍历操作的非递归算法 被引量:3
11
作者 詹泽梅 《电脑知识与技术》 2017年第10期40-42,共3页
二叉树和图是数据结构中非常重要的内容,遍历操作是它们的最基本的操作。由于递归函数执行过程系统开销较大,因此该文研究了遍历操作的非递归算法。论文介绍了二叉树遍历和图的深度优先搜索操作定义,分析了操作的非递归算法解决思路,并... 二叉树和图是数据结构中非常重要的内容,遍历操作是它们的最基本的操作。由于递归函数执行过程系统开销较大,因此该文研究了遍历操作的非递归算法。论文介绍了二叉树遍历和图的深度优先搜索操作定义,分析了操作的非递归算法解决思路,并给出详细的非递归算法。 展开更多
关键词 非递归 先序遍历 深度优搜索 数据结构
下载PDF
一种由层次遍历和其它遍历构造二叉树的新算法
12
作者 王防修 刘春红 《武汉轻工大学学报》 2016年第4期67-72,共6页
在由遍历序列构造二叉树问题的研究中,针对目前还没有用层次遍历和其它遍历一起构造二叉树的问题,提出了一种由层次遍历和其它遍历一起构造二叉树的新算法。考虑到层次遍历中左子树和右子树的层次遍历不具有递归属性,设计了从层次遍历... 在由遍历序列构造二叉树问题的研究中,针对目前还没有用层次遍历和其它遍历一起构造二叉树的问题,提出了一种由层次遍历和其它遍历一起构造二叉树的新算法。考虑到层次遍历中左子树和右子树的层次遍历不具有递归属性,设计了从层次遍历中分离出左右子树层次遍历的方法,并且通过组合得到具有递归属性的层次遍历。通过对层次遍历和中序遍历的递归属性的研究,设计了由层次遍历和中序遍历构造二叉树的递归算法;通过对层次遍历和先序遍历的递归属性的研究,设计了由层次遍历和中序遍历构造没有出度为1的二叉树的递归算法;通过对层次遍历和后序遍历的递归属性的研究,设计了由层次遍历和后序遍历构造没有出度为1的二叉树的递归算法。仿真结果表明,用设计的算法构造二叉树是有效的,可为二叉树的构造提供新算法。 展开更多
关键词 层次遍历 先序遍历 遍历 遍历 递归算法
下载PDF
浅议二叉树的遍历 被引量:5
13
作者 郭金华 占明 《科技信息》 2010年第17期65-65,共1页
所谓遍历是指沿着某条搜索路线,依次对树中每个结点均做一次且仅做一次访问。访问结点所做的操作依赖于具体的应用问题。
关键词 先序遍历 遍历 遍历 搜索
下载PDF
数据结构中二叉树的生成及遍历非递归算法浅析 被引量:1
14
作者 吉冬梅 《办公自动化(综合月刊)》 2010年第1期30-31,共2页
本文主要介绍数据结构中二叉树的生成,以及二叉树的先序、中序和后序的非递归算法。
关键词 二叉树 二叉树先序遍历 二叉树中遍历 二叉树后遍历
下载PDF
基于修剪枝的二进制树形搜索反碰撞算法与实现 被引量:18
15
作者 余松森 詹宜巨 《计算机工程》 CAS CSCD 北大核心 2005年第16期217-218,230,共3页
标签冲突是射频识别(RFID)技术的常见问题。解决此问题的反碰撞算法有ALOHA算法、分隙ALOHA算法。这些算法同时对大量标签操作时,效率较低。本算法依据阅读器作用区域内,有限个标签的EPC代码构成的二进制树存在许多空闲结点,搜索时忽略... 标签冲突是射频识别(RFID)技术的常见问题。解决此问题的反碰撞算法有ALOHA算法、分隙ALOHA算法。这些算法同时对大量标签操作时,效率较低。本算法依据阅读器作用区域内,有限个标签的EPC代码构成的二进制树存在许多空闲结点,搜索时忽略空闲结点,可以高效地识别所有标签。随后采用树的先序遍历思想予以实现,最终算法模拟表明:该算法对大量标签操作时效率稳定在46.22%附近。 展开更多
关键词 修剪枝 二进制树 反碰撞 标签冲突 RFID 先序遍历
下载PDF
一种动态目录树快速生成算法 被引量:5
16
作者 陈德军 马英哲 周祖德 《武汉理工大学学报(交通科学与工程版)》 2008年第1期40-42,共3页
提出了一种生成目录树的快速算法,阐述了实现该算法的数据表的设计思想,结合先序遍历的方法,给出了基于该类型数据库的目录树生成算法的实现过程.通过与传统目录树生成方法的比较,阐明了新算法的优越性.对该算法可能会遇到的问题提出了... 提出了一种生成目录树的快速算法,阐述了实现该算法的数据表的设计思想,结合先序遍历的方法,给出了基于该类型数据库的目录树生成算法的实现过程.通过与传统目录树生成方法的比较,阐明了新算法的优越性.对该算法可能会遇到的问题提出了一种解决方案. 展开更多
关键词 目录树 结点 数据库 先序遍历
下载PDF
JSP中BOM动态显示与隐藏的关键技术 被引量:1
17
作者 龚祝平 《计算机工程与设计》 CSCD 北大核心 2007年第8期1909-1910,1943,共3页
BOM表达的是产品与零部件之间的相互关系,它是生产制造企业的核心数据之一。为了在JSP的客户端实现BOM信息的动态逐层显示与隐藏,就需要对产品的BOM信息进行先序遍历,将存储于数据库中的BOM信息提取出来,并存储到Java2中的Vector类的对... BOM表达的是产品与零部件之间的相互关系,它是生产制造企业的核心数据之一。为了在JSP的客户端实现BOM信息的动态逐层显示与隐藏,就需要对产品的BOM信息进行先序遍历,将存储于数据库中的BOM信息提取出来,并存储到Java2中的Vector类的对象中,然后将树状结构BOM信息的每一层都实现为一个DIV,通过JavaScript代码控制DIV的显示与隐藏来实现BOM信息在客户端的动态逐层显示与隐藏。 展开更多
关键词 物料清单 企业资源计划 动态逐层显示与隐藏 先序遍历 客户端动态技术
下载PDF
C语言多重指针在二叉链表操作中的应用 被引量:1
18
作者 闫冰一 李晔 《郑州工业高等专科学校学报》 2002年第3期16-17,共2页
针对学生在实现二叉链表建立操作中遇到的困难,指出了在建立二叉链表的操作中用指针和多重指针作形参的常见错误,深入讨论了指针和多重指针作形参的实质以及如何帮助学生克服这一困难。
关键词 C语言 操作 二叉树 二叉链表 多重指针 先序遍历
下载PDF
稳定婚姻匹配问题的一个快速枚举算法 被引量:6
19
作者 宋旭东 纪秀花 《工程图学学报》 CSCD 北大核心 2010年第3期187-192,共6页
稳定匹配问题是算法理论中的典型问题之一,稳定婚姻匹配问题则是一种解决二部图匹配问题的模型。论文对稳定婚姻匹配问题进行了简单的阐述,并介绍了求解典型稳定婚姻问题的Gale-Shapley算法的基本思想及其性质。为了快速求出所有的稳定... 稳定匹配问题是算法理论中的典型问题之一,稳定婚姻匹配问题则是一种解决二部图匹配问题的模型。论文对稳定婚姻匹配问题进行了简单的阐述,并介绍了求解典型稳定婚姻问题的Gale-Shapley算法的基本思想及其性质。为了快速求出所有的稳定匹配结果,提出了基于先序遍历森林的快速枚举算法。由Gale-Shapley算法的性质得到一个定理及其推论,利用得到的推论对算法做了进一步改进和优化。在满足推论的特定条件下,提高了算法的执行效率。 展开更多
关键词 计算机应用 算法理论 稳定婚姻匹配 先序遍历 森林 枚举
下载PDF
一种新的简化ID3决策树的算法 被引量:3
20
作者 吴宣为 史斌宁 《合肥工业大学学报(自然科学版)》 CAS CSCD 2004年第12期1565-1569,共5页
决策树简化是决策树学习算法中的一个重要分支。文章以 ID3算法构造的决策树为基础 ,提出了一种高效的简化决策树的算法。算法先序遍历由 ID3构造出来的决策树的各个节点并对其子树进行比较 ,如果各子树的属性都相同而且存在某些相应的... 决策树简化是决策树学习算法中的一个重要分支。文章以 ID3算法构造的决策树为基础 ,提出了一种高效的简化决策树的算法。算法先序遍历由 ID3构造出来的决策树的各个节点并对其子树进行比较 ,如果各子树的属性都相同而且存在某些相应的分支对于各子树完全相同 ,则改变决策树中相应属性的层次关系并把相同的分支分别合并起来。算法减少了决策树的深度、宽度与叶子数目 ,降低了决策树的规模。尤其对于逻辑表达式的归纳学习 ,简化之后的决策树要明显优于原决策树。 展开更多
关键词 简化决策树 先序遍历 子树比较 分支合并
下载PDF
上一页 1 2 下一页 到第
使用帮助 返回顶部